The Rise of Digital Infrastructure in the Casino Industry
Historically, casino operations relied heavily on manual processes, paper-based tracking, and siloed data management. However, the advent of digital platforms has revolutionized this landscape. Today, casinos require real-time data integration, seamless point-of-sale (POS) systems, and robust back-end management tools to meet the increasing demands for transparency, security, and operational agility.
Core Challenges Addressed by Modern WMS Platforms
| Challenge | Implication | WMS Solution |
|---|---|---|
| Inventory Management | High-value assets like gaming chips, electronic equipment, and supplies require meticulous tracking. | Automated tracking and real-time inventory updates ensure loss prevention and optimal stock levels. |
| Regulatory Compliance | Stringent UK and international regulations demand detailed audit trails. | Integrated audit logs and compliance modules support transparent reporting. |
| Asset Security | Unauthorized access or theft can severely damage operations and reputation. | Access controls, RFID tracking, and alarm integrations fortify security. |
| Operational Efficiency | Manual processes result in delays and errors. | Automation streamlines logistics, stock replenishment, and reporting workflows. |

Emerging Technologies and Future Directions
Innovations like artificial intelligence (AI), machine learning (ML), and Internet of Things (IoT) sensors are poised to further redefine WMS capabilities. Predictive analytics can forecast inventory needs based on player traffic patterns, while IoT devices enhance security and asset management precision.
